Transaction 7950d617478e2b33b6243963ce5db650c16c03a167b7b9ec2835403ac2a9ef27
1 Input
1 Output
-
7950d617478e2b33b6243963ce5db650c16c03a167b7b9ec2835403ac2a9ef27:0
- value
- 8463662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d482c405fa67fdcc13ce54489a808cf3c019f538 OP_EQUAL
- address
- 3M4fpyPbM6GaALRTLVnzg5aCdrg54fYLmR